Just two days before the official launch of Motorola Droid X, Verizon
will push Android 2.2 Froyo update to Motorola Droid phones. eWeek.com
reported with the reference of Brighthand blog that Verizon will
upgrade Motorola Droid on July 13. It is already confirmed that Droid
supports the latest Google Mobile OS as unofficial Android 2.2 ROM for
Motorola Droid is available online.

Verizon will launch two Android powered phones in the next couple of
months. The wireless company and Motorola will release Motorola Droid
X on July 15 with Android 2.1 as default OS. Verizon has also
confirmed that it will make Droid 2 available on August 23 however
Droid 2 will be released with Android 2.2. Droid X will cost $199 with
$100 rebate. The price will be only valid with 2 year Verizon Wireless
data and voice service contract. Verizon has confirmed that it will
push Android 2.2 to Motorola Droid X after its release.

There is no confirmation if HTC Droid Incredible will also get Android
2.2. However considering the high-end hardware of the device, the
Froyo update for Incredible makes sense.
